Everyone sick of rain yet? Hopefully by the end of the weekend we will see some sun but in the mean time, here are five things you should know about Friday, March 11.

  1. Put a Song in Your Heart: The Montville High School theatre program is presenting their Spring musical “Merrily We Roll Along.” We’ll have a story up on it later today, but in the meantime, you can get tickets for the play through this website.
  2. Get Some Medical Know-How at the Library: Acupuncturist Joseph Tonzola will be giving a talk at the Montville public library at 1 p.m. as part of the library’s ongoing . The talk is being co-sponsored by Atlantic Health and is free to attend.
  3. Everyone is Irish in Mo-Town: Morristown is going full-bore St. Patrick’s Day with a performance by Irish band , then again on Saturday with the , from 12 to 2 p.m. on the Green.
  4. No More Rain? After Thursday’s rainfall, the National Weather Service is some relief for Montville. There is a 30 percent chance of precipitation before 11 a.m., but the township can expect a high of 57.
  5. Get some Fish: Friday marks the first Friday of Lent, so all you practicing catholics out there are going to need a place to get some fish. The Bonefish Grill in Pine Brook is open from 4 to 11:30 p.m.
